Impact of Planting Date on Melanaphis sacchari (Hemiptera: Aphididae) Population Dynamics and Grain Sorghum Yield

Abstract: The sugarcane aphid, Melanaphis sacchari (Zehntner) (Hemiptera: Aphididae), has become a major pest of grain sorghum, Sorghum bicolor (L.) Moench, in the United States in recent years. Feeding by large densities of sugarcane aphids causes severe damage, which can lead to a total loss of yield in extreme cases. Our objective was to determine the effect of grain sorghum planting date on sugarcane aphid population dynamics and their potential to reduce yields. “…They theorized that this was due to higher aphid densities. Shifting the planting date did not change the timeframe of infestation but solely the growth stage of the crop when the infestation occurred (Haar, 2018; Seiter et al., 2019). This emphasizes the potential of using planting date to aid in the management of sugarcane aphid, as up to 100% yield loss has been documented when sugarcane aphids infest at late vegetative to early reproductive growth stages compared with only 21% by soft dough (Catchot et al., 2015).…”
